Post subject:  how to enable both analog and digital audio?

I am using a dragon 2 system, and have had it set up for quite some time outputting analog stereo off of the motherboard to a stereo system. I had never used the s/pdif output.

My project is to start using mythmusic and output the audio to a different stereo system via the s/pdif output, but still output the TV audio via the analog output.

I actually got this working, but I dont know what I did. I like to understand how things work, and was hoping someone on here can offer insight.

as i started the endeavor, i connected the optical cable to the s/pdif output of the dragon system, changed the output of mythmusic to /dev/sound/dsp and unchecked "mythmusic" in the linhes audio setup screen. i did not see the optical cable light up, and there was no audio. audio from mythmusic still came out of the analog output.

i then ran twk_audio.pl --implement digital and the optical cable light up and i started outputting both mythmusic and TV audio out of the digital out. the lihhes audio setup screen was still set up for analog, so i did not understand why tv video audio was being sent to the digital output.

i then reran twk_audio.pl to go back to analogstereo. i was sill getting all audio out of digital.

i then removed the /etc/asound.conf that was newly created after running the tweaker script. after a reboot, the tv audio was coming out of the analog output, and the mythmusic was coming out of the digital. so, i accomplished my goal, but it makes no sense to me that that route got me there.

does anyone know the proper way to enable both analog and digital output for specific applications?
